‘How to setup an SSH Server on Windows in 3 easy steps’ just dropped

Walk through of how to setup an SSH Server on Windows, this walk through is done on Windows 10 but can be done with the same steps on Windows 11, and Windows Server OS's.

Install SSH Server:
Apps & Features -\ Option features -\ Add features -\ OpenSSH Server -\ install it!

Start Service and set to automatic:
Services -\ OpenSSH -\ Start
--- Startup type -\ Automatic

Check Firewall Rule:
Windows Defender Firewall -\ Advanced settings -\ check for "OPenSSH-Server-In-TCP" rule
